Fax presents works by a multigenerational group use the fax machine as a tool for thinking and drawing.
Published to accompany an exhibition at New York's Drawing Center, FAX includes the drawings, texts, examples of early telecommunications art (with inevitable transmission errors), junk faxes and fax lore that were all transmitted via the gallery's fax line.

Old News 4
Old News is a non-profit free newspaper organized by Jacob Fabricius, presenting a selection of articles and images cut from newspapers by artists.
Michalis Pichler was invited by Victor Palacios to contribute to the "Animal" section of "Old News#4" and contributed Old "Old News" News: all the animals as depicted in the previous "Old News" issues (available at the time of invitation: #1 and #2).
Eventually two of them were printed in Old News4. The "animals" were cut out by their shape and subsequently printed "sculpturally", that is with the cut out matching on front and back side of the page.

basso magazin #5 out of place
Basso is a zine that cleverly mixes sex and art with a bit of politics thrown in. It doesn’t have consumer friendly periodical standards such as page numbers or editorial introductions but can be seen as a montage of ideas in text and image, put together to an intuitive flow. Basso devotes each issue to a particular concept; Issue 5's is "Out of Place," which is also the title of a fold-out color poster by Yusuf Etiman.
